Output 61b5016b1cf55411929d03f1fe4ca714b1f55701414263bf1c4160e930b2f144:21

value
3383436
script pubkey
OP_0 OP_PUSHBYTES_20 5a3ec99de80f51e9aaed7873f150788bfde777a7
address
bc1qtglvn80gpag7n2hd0pelz5rc3077waa87368fh
transaction
61b5016b1cf55411929d03f1fe4ca714b1f55701414263bf1c4160e930b2f144